We are hiring a Staff Nurse for one of the best Nursing Homes in Co Waterford who is passionate about improving the quality of life of their residents and places a strong importance on social physical and mental stimulation.
This position is open only to applicants who hold EU/EEA citizenship or have an existing unrestricted right to work in Ireland.
Responsibilities
Deliver high-quality safe and effective nursing care in accordance with NMBI standards and professional best practice.
Assess plan implement and evaluate individualised person-centred care plans.
Administer medications safely and accurately in line with organisational policies and procedures.
Monitor residents clinical condition document findings and respond appropriately to changes in health status.
Lead support and supervise care staff during shifts to ensure safe and effective service delivery.
Promote residents independence dignity and overall quality of life.
Communicate effectively with residents families GPs and the multidisciplinary team to support coordinated care.
Maintain accurate timely and confidential clinical documentation.
Ensure ongoing compliance with HIQA regulations organisational policies and evidence-based practice
Requirements
Hold a Registered General Nurse qualification.
Must be an EU/EEA citizenship or have an existing unrestricted right to work in Ireland.
Maintain active registration with the Nursing and Midwifery Board of Ireland (NMBI).
Demonstrate strong clinical knowledge with a clear commitment to person-centred care.
Possess excellent communication organisational and leadership skills.
Be fluent in spoken and written English.
Have satisfactory Garda clearance and appropriate professional references
